Background levels of some trace elements in egyptian soils determined by neutron activation analysis

As part of a research program on the influence of agricultural practices and activities on soil content of heavy metals. The present work was carried out to investigate the feasibility of instrumental neutron activation analysis for this purpose. Elements studied were, Fe, Zn, Co, Sc, Sb, As, Cd, Hg and Cr. The soil samples analyzed were from different locations to represent different land uses and types. Results revealed that As, Cd and Hg show a pronounced accumulation in soils especially those exposed to industrial and organic wastes disposal. 2 tabs
